Abstract
The communication between various intelligent network devices for the ADMS interfaces, it is necessary to deploy an appropriate communication network to meet the requirements of all intelligent network components.A very common problem encountered in smart grid design and deployment lies in the definition of the communication network that will serve the project. Many ways of developing communication network projects have been tested in Brazil, all in urban areas where the cellular network is abundant and the endpoints are close to each other.In this paper, we list all the steps that led us to decide on the adoption of a LoRaWAN communication network and how this network is being implemented in the CPFL / UFSM / ANEEL project in southern Brazil in a rural area and testing with experimental LORAWAN network in UFSM Campus.
